Transaction e36842936d55c37f3c9b5e3e7e5cd225714e61da5a6e2f23b2202a04696ace7d
1 Input
1 Output
-
e36842936d55c37f3c9b5e3e7e5cd225714e61da5a6e2f23b2202a04696ace7d:0
- value
- 1483878
- script pubkey
- OP_0 OP_PUSHBYTES_20 20ef2e3cce20fbc854db50caa89bcf6f99d62390
- address
- bc1qyrhju0xwyraus4xm2r923x70d7vavgusuayq85